The GXV3140-V2 is new Grandstream Networks’ third IP video phone with Skype video feature.
The other two are the GXV3000, which was released in 2006, and the GXV3005, which was added in December 2008 and is basically the 3000 with FXO ports.
The new phone blends real-time video conference capability with a number of Web and social networking applications. You can use the phone to web browsing, IM over Google, MSN and Yahoo, track RSS feeds, listen to internet radio and also stream from the included SD card slot or USB port. There is also an alarm clock, calendar, music ring tones and 3-way conferencing. Additionally the phone integrates with Yahoo's Flickr service so you can use it instead of a digital photo frame.
